    Abstract: A shell includes an insulating layer provided at an outer surface of the shell and including a repair part formed of a curable material and having a shape of a mushroom. The repair part includes an upper part having a shape of a cover of the mushroom and a lower part having a shape of a stem of the mushroom. The lower part is embedded in the insulating layer, the upper part protrudes from the insulating layer, and a lower surface of the upper part covers at least a portion of an upper surface of the insulating layer. In a cross section of the repair part perpendicular to a surface of the insulating layer, a longest dimension of the upper part is greater than or equal to a sum of a width of the lower part and a creepage distance of a battery.

    Abstract: A surgical stapling device includes a tool assembly having a U-shaped frame, an anvil assembly, and a cartridge assembly. The cartridge assembly includes a knife that is movable between retracted and advanced positions. The anvil assembly is supported on the distal frame portion and includes a cutting plate and an anvil plate. The cutting plate is positioned between the distal frame portion and the anvil plate and is engaged by the knife as the knife moves from the retracted position towards the advanced position. The cutting plate is formed of a material that deforms locally and structurally upon engagement with the knife.

    Abstract: A surgical instrument comprising a handle assembly, an elongated portion, a head portion, an approximation mechanism, and a lockout mechanism is disclosed. The handle assembly comprises a movable handle and a stationary handle. The elongated portion extends distally from the handle assembly and defines a longitudinal axis. The head portion is disposed adjacent a distal portion of the elongated portion, and comprises a first jaw member and a second jaw member. The approximation mechanism comprises a drive member disposed in mechanical cooperation with the first jaw member and is configured to longitudinally move the first jaw member in relation to the second jaw member. The lockout mechanism is configured to selectively permit actuation of the movable handle to eject fasteners from the second jaw member. The lockout mechanism comprises a pin extending from the movable handle and is slidingly engaged with a slot in the drive member.

    Abstract: A reposable surgical clip applier includes a handle assembly, a shaft assembly, and a clip cartridge assembly. The shaft assembly includes a pair of jaws and a drive assembly. The clip cartridge assembly includes a stack of surgical clips supported therein and a clip pusher. When the shaft assembly is releasably engaged with the handle assembly and the clip cartridge assembly is releasably engaged within the shaft assembly, a pusher bar of the drive assembly is operably positioned relative to the clip pusher and the handle assembly is operably associated with the drive assembly such that actuation of a trigger of the handle assembly moves the pusher bar distally to load the distal-most clip of the stack of surgical clips into the pair of jaws and moves the jaws-engaging portion distally to cam the pair of jaws towards one another to form the distal-most clip about tissue.

    Abstract: A surgical device includes a handle assembly and a firing counter assembly. The handle assembly includes a housing defining a window, a trigger, and a drive member axially movable within the housing and operatively coupled with the trigger. The firing counter assembly includes a camming pin and a sleeve rotatably supported about the drive member and defining a continuous groove. The sleeve has indicia circumferentially arranged about the sleeve and corresponding to the number of surgical clips in the surgical device. The camming pin is supported on the drive member for concomitant axial displacement with the drive member. The camming pin is configured to slide through the continuous groove of the sleeve, wherein actuation of the trigger causes rotation of the sleeve such that the indicia corresponding to the number of surgical clips remaining in the surgical device is shown through the window of the housing.

    Abstract: A reposable endoscopic surgical clip applier includes a handle assembly (100) configured to releasably engage at least two different endoscopic assemblies (200,300,400). The handle assembly (100) is configured such that a ratcheting function thereof is disabled upon engagement of an endoscopic assembly (300) therewith that is not intended for ratcheting use and such that the ratcheting function is enabled upon engagement of an endoscopic assembly (400) therewith that is intended for ratcheting use. Endoscopic assemblies (200,300,400) for use with the handle assembly (100) are also provided.

    Abstract: An endoscopic surgical device is provided and includes a handle assembly including a handle housing and a trigger operatively connected to the handle housing, and a drive mechanism actuatable by the trigger; and an endoscopic assembly selectively connectable to the handle assembly. The endoscopic assembly includes an outer tube defining a lumen therethrough and having a helical thread disposed within the lumen thereof; an inner tube rotatably supported in the outer tube and being operatively connectable to the drive mechanism, the inner tube defining a splined distal end, wherein the splined distal end of the inner tube is defined by a pair of opposed longitudinally extending tines and a pair of opposed longitudinally extending channels; and a plurality of surgical anchors loaded in the splined distal end of the inner tube.
